Cognitive Side Effects of Antiseizure Medications in Adults with Epilepsy
This explainer reviews what research says about cognitive side effects of antiseizure medications in adults with epilepsy.
Source: CNS drugs
Summary
What was studied
This narrative review examined published research on how antiseizure medications may affect cognitive abilities, mostly in adults with epilepsy. The authors searched PubMed for studies published from January 2009 through December 2025 and considered evidence from randomized controlled trials, observational studies, meta-analyses, and systematic reviews.
The review focused on medications introduced into clinical practice since a prior 2009 review. It considered effects on attention, processing speed, memory, language, and executive function, as well as vulnerability among older adults and people with intellectual disabilities.
What they found
Newer medications—including rufinamide, lacosamide, brivaracetam, cannabidiol, fenfluramine, and ganaxolone—generally showed favorable cognitive profiles at recommended doses, particularly when used alone or in carefully selected combinations. Eslicarbazepine and cenobamate may be associated with mild, dose-dependent cognitive effects at the upper end of their recommended dose ranges.
Older medications and certain second-generation drugs, particularly topiramate and zonisamide, were consistently associated with higher cognitive risks. Older adults and people with intellectual disabilities may be especially vulnerable. The review emphasizes that cognitive difficulties in epilepsy are multifactorial, reflecting disease-related mechanisms, treatment effects, and their interaction.
Limits of the evidence
This was a narrative review rather than a single clinical trial. The abstract does not report the number of studies or participants, nor does it provide numerical estimates of how often cognitive effects occurred or how large they were for each medication. The evidence came from several types of studies, and the abstract does not provide enough detail to assess or directly compare their methods and findings.
For families and caregivers
Cognitive side effects may add to the day-to-day and psychosocial burden of epilepsy. The review supports balancing seizure control with cognitive preservation through individualized medication selection, cautious dose adjustment, and minimizing the use of multiple medications when appropriate. Cognitive problems should not automatically be attributed to medication because epilepsy-related mechanisms may also contribute.

Terms in this summary
- antiseizure medication
- A medicine used to prevent or reduce seizures.
- cognitive function
- Mental abilities such as attention, memory, language, planning, and speed of thinking.
- executive function
- Skills used to plan, organize, solve problems, and control behavior.
- monotherapy
- Treatment with one antiseizure medication.
- polytherapy
- Treatment with more than one antiseizure medication at the same time.
- dose-dependent
- An effect that may become more likely or stronger as the medication dose increases.
- cautious titration
- Adjusting a medication dose gradually while monitoring its effects.
- narrative review
- A broad synthesis and interpretation of previously published research.
